python requests发送multipart/form-data编码

  • 时间:
  • 来源:互联网
  • 文章标签:
from requests_toolbelt import MultipartEncoder
import requests

m = MultipartEncoder(
	# formdata 参数
    fields={
            'field0': 'value', 
            'field1': 'value',
            'field2': ('filename', open('file.py', 'rb'), 'text/plain'),
            'filed3': ("aab.jpg", open("aab.jpg", 'rb'), "image/jpeg")# 上传图片文件路径及类型
})
          
})

r = requests.post('url链接', data=m,
                  headers={'Content-Type': m.content_type},)
print(r.text)

原文链接

本文链接http://www.taodudu.cc/news/show-1781907.html